This piece is also made entirely from sand and dirt. It explores a simple but profound truth: for most of human history, people lived without knowing what they looked like. Mirrors were rare or non-existent. A person’s only glimpse of themselves would have come through still water.
Man: First Reflection imagines the moment when early consciousness encountered its own image - the first time earth became aware of itself. As Carl Sagan once said, “We are a way for the universe to know itself.” This is that moment.
